The School Education Act 1999 requires all enrolled student to attend school or participate in an educational program of the school. Principals are required to record and monitor student attendance and develop appropriate strategies to restore attendance for students with persistent absence.

These procedures aim to maximise the flexibility available to school communities in the configuration of the school day within the constraints of legislation and industrial agreements. The Director General determines the days in each year on which government schools are to be open for educational instruction of students.
